<code dir="1tuzk0"></code><sub id="6vb2_u"></sub><strong lang="vftol8"></strong><dl date-time="r6stzy"></dl><noframes draggable="r354ia">

        引言

        在数字货币的浪潮中,加密钱包作为重要的工具,承载着虚拟资产的存储和交易。但很多用户在使用加密钱包时,往往对其背后的密码学原理知之甚少。本文将深入探讨加密钱包背后的密码学原理、算法及其在安全性上的重要性,同时解答一些用户可能产生的疑问。

        加密钱包的基本概念

        加密钱包是一种用于存储、发送和接收数字货币的工具。与传统的钱包不同,加密钱包并不存储实体货币,而是通过一对密钥(公钥和私钥)来管理数字资产。公钥用于接收货币,而私钥则用于授权交易,是保护数字资产安全的关键所在。

        密码学在加密钱包中的作用

        密码学是加密钱包的核心,主要涉及加密算法和哈希函数。对用户来说,理解这些基础知识是确保资产安全的前提。

        1. **对称加密与非对称加密**:在加密钱包的设计中,非对称加密尤为重要。每个用户的私钥和公钥是一对数学上相关的密钥。公钥可公开,任何人都可以发送数字资产给该公钥;然而,只有拥有相应私钥的用户才能发送资产,确保了交易的安全。

        2. **哈希函数**:哈希函数用于数据的完整性校验。加密钱包中,交易记录(即区块链上的数据)会经过哈希处理,生成固定长度的哈希值,任何对数据的改动都会导致哈希值的变化,便于检测。

        加密钱包的安全性与挑战

        尽管加密钱包在数字货币的管理中起到至关重要的作用,但其安全性仍面临诸多挑战。用户在使用时需要了解潜在的风险及保护措施。

        1. **私钥泄露**:私钥是保护用户资产的核心,一旦私钥被他人获取,资产将面临极大的风险。因此,用户应确保私钥不被泄露,使用硬件钱包等离线存储方式时需格外小心。

        2. **钓鱼攻击与恶意软件**:不少黑客会通过钓鱼网站或恶意软件获取用户的私钥。用户在输入密码或私钥时,应确保使用官方渠道并定期更新设备的安全软件。

        可能相关的问题及解答

        1. 加密钱包的工作原理是什么?

          加密钱包的工作原理主要基于公钥加密和哈希函数。用户生成一对密钥,公钥用于接收数字资产,私钥用于签署交易。每笔交易都需要通过私钥进行授权,从而确保资金的合法性与安全性。此外,加密钱包还利用哈希算法来确保交易记录的完整性与安全性。在交易完成后,相关信息被记录到区块链中,使得每笔交易都可以公开且不可篡改。

        2. 如何安全存储私钥?

          安全存储私钥的方式多种多样,用户应根据自身需求选择合适的方法。一些常见的安全存储方式包括使用硬件钱包、冷钱包(离线存储)、以及备份私钥等。此外,还应定期更新安全措施,使用强密码和双重身份验证来提高安全性。

        3. 加密钱包与银行账户有什么区别?

          加密钱包与传统银行账户在很多方面都有显著区别:首先,加密钱包是去中心化的,不受政府或金融机构控制,而银行账户则受到监管。其次, 加密钱包的交易通常是匿名的,而银行交易则需要身份验证。最后,加密钱包的安全性主要依赖于用户的私钥,而银行则通过多层安全机制来保护用户资产。

        4. 未来加密钱包的发展趋势是什么?

          加密钱包在未来的发展中,可能会更加注重安全性和用户体验。随着区块链技术的不断发展,新型的加密算法和安全措施可能会应用于钱包中。此外,去中心化金融(DeFi)和非同质化代币(NFT)等领域的发展,也可能催生出新的基于链上资产管理的钱包工具,为用户提供更高效、安全的资产管理方式。

        总结

        随着数字货币的普及,加密钱包的重要性日益凸显。了解加密钱包背后的密码学原理可以帮助用户更好地管理和保护自己的数字资产。通过本文的探讨,我们看到加密钱包不仅是资产的存储工具,更是数字身份和交易安全的保障。希望每位用户都能在使用加密钱包过程中,充分认识到安全性的重要性,从而采取必要措施保护自身资产。

        加密钱包的背后是复杂而精密的密码学体系,随着技术的进步,其安全性也在不断演进,用户有必要保持学习和更新,以应对未来可能出现的挑战。